Transaction 638841e1364946eceaf68966436b61d354f1e1601afe84334789f2d09a9f7013
1 Input
1 Output
-
638841e1364946eceaf68966436b61d354f1e1601afe84334789f2d09a9f7013:0
- value
- 839371
- script pubkey
- OP_0 OP_PUSHBYTES_32 816846f855ce7c660fbaa9e12967a45233aabd160b0937012dd3b468ad8d8c43
- address
- bc1qs95yd7z4ee7xvra648sjjeay2ge640gkpvynwqfd6w6x3tvd33psl73wa2